nps.gov | Neubacher Named Superintendent of Yosemite National Park

WASHINGTON – Don Neubacher has been selected as the new superintendent of Yosemite National Park in California. Neubacher takes over from David Uberuaga who has been acting superintendent since Mike Tollefson retired last year.

Merced Sun Star | Public Review for New Yosemite Study

The public is invited to review the environmental study that favors building a new Yosemite Environmental Education Center at Henness Ridge near Yosemite West.
